Early Life and Diagnosis

Let’s rewind to the beginning. Hunter was born with fibular hemimelia, a condition where parts of his legs were underdeveloped. At just 14 months old, doctors recommended amputation to give him a better quality of life. Can you imagine hearing something like that as a parent? But instead of seeing it as the end, Hunter’s family saw it as the start of a new chapter.

After the surgery, Hunter adapted quickly. He learned to navigate the world with prosthetic legs, proving early on that he wasn’t going to let anything hold him back. This resilience set the tone for the rest of his life.

Breaking Barriers: Hunter’s Breakthrough

Hunter’s breakthrough moment came when he qualified for the 2016 Paralympic Games in Rio de Janeiro. At just 17 years old, he became the youngest member of the U.S. Paralympic Track and Field team. This was a huge deal, not just for him but for the entire Paralympic community. It showed that age and disability are no barriers to achieving greatness.

During the games, Hunter competed in the T42 100m and 200m sprints, finishing fourth in both events. While he didn’t win a medal, his performance earned him recognition and respect from athletes and fans alike.

Challenges Faced Along the Way

Of course, Hunter’s journey wasn’t without its challenges. From dealing with societal perceptions of disability to overcoming injuries and setbacks, he faced numerous hurdles. But instead of letting them defeat him, Hunter used them as stepping stones to success.

One of the biggest challenges he faced was finding the right prosthetic legs for running. It took years of trial and error to develop prosthetics that allowed him to compete at the highest level. And even then, there were moments when things didn’t go according to plan. But Hunter’s determination kept him moving forward.
